Exploring the art, science, and impact of cricket's speed specialists
AFast Bowleris a cricketer who specializes in bowling the cricket ball at high speeds, typically aiming to dismiss batsmen through pace, bounce, and movement.
In the dynamic world of cricket, the role of aFast Bowleris both physically demanding and strategically crucial. These athletes combine raw power with technical precision to challenge batsmen with deliveries that can exceed 90 miles per hour (145 km/h). The very essence of aFast Bowlerlies in their ability to generate tremendous velocity while maintaining control and variation.

A successfulFast Bowlertypically possesses exceptional physical fitness, strong shoulders and back, flexible joints, and the mental fortitude to maintain intensity throughout long spells of bowling.
The psychological dimension of fast bowling cannot be overstated. A skilledFast Bowlerdoesn't just rely on speed but uses it as a foundation for strategic variation. They study batsmen's weaknesses, set traps with field placements, and build pressure through consistent line and length.
Throughout cricket history, nations have developed distinct fast bowling traditions. The Caribbean produced tall, intimidating bowlers who exploited bounce, while Pakistani bowlers mastered reverse swing. Australian fast bowlers combined aggression with relentless accuracy, creating diverse approaches within theFast Bowlerdiscipline.
Mastering diverse bowling techniques separates good fast bowlers from great ones. While raw speed provides the foundation, variation in delivery makes aFast Bowlertruly dangerous and unpredictable.
The art of making the ball move laterally in the air through refined grip and seam position. Outswingers move away from right-handed batsmen, while inswingers move toward them.
An advanced technique where the ball swings in the opposite direction to conventional swing, typically with an older ball. Mastering reverse swing requires precise ball maintenance and exceptional skill.
The bouncer aims at the batsman's head or shoulder height, while the yorker targets the base of the stumps or batsman's feet. These contrasting lengths create uncertainty and discomfort.
Off-cutters and leg-cutters deviate off the pitch rather than swinging in the air. These slower variations disrupt batting rhythm and can be particularly effective in limited-overs cricket.
The world record for the fastest delivery by aFast Bowleris 161.3 km/h (100.2 mph), bowled by Shoaib Akhtar of Pakistan against England in the 2003 Cricket World Cup.
The making of a world-classFast Bowlerinvolves rigorous, specialized training that develops both the physical attributes and technical skills required for high-performance bowling.
Modern fast bowling demands comprehensive physical preparation. Strength training focuses on developing powerful legs for the run-up, a strong core for stability during delivery, and robust shoulders for generating pace. Unlike many athletes, aFast Bowlermust balance strength with flexibility to prevent injuries.

Technical proficiency separates consistent performers from occasional ones. Bowling coaches work with fast bowlers on run-up consistency, wrist position at release, follow-through mechanics, and variations. Video analysis has become an indispensable tool for refining technique.
The metabolic demands of fast bowling require careful nutritional planning. High protein intake supports muscle repair, while complex carbohydrates provide sustained energy. Hydration strategies are critical, especially in hot climates. Recovery protocols including ice baths, compression garments, and adequate sleep are essential for maintaining performance throughout a season.
Fast bowling has one of the highest injury rates in sports. Preventive measures include core strengthening, flexibility work, workload management, and technical adjustments to reduce stress on the back and legs.
Cricket history is decorated with exceptional fast bowlers who have left an indelible mark on the game through their skill, determination, and iconic performances.
Widely regarded as one of the greatest fast bowlers of all time, Lillee combined classical technique with fierce competitiveness. His partnership with Jeff Thomson formed one of cricket's most feared bowling attacks.
The "Sultan of Swing" mastered both conventional and reverse swing with unparalleled skill. Akram's ability to bowl devastating spells with both new and old balls made him a complete fast bowling package.
Despite his relatively short stature, Marshall generated fearsome pace and movement. His skiddy trajectory and late swing made him exceptionally difficult to face, particularly in helpful conditions.
The epitome of accuracy and consistency, McGrath demonstrated that fast bowling excellence isn't solely about raw pace. His metronomic line and length, combined with subtle movement, brought him 563 Test wickets.
Contemporary cricket features exceptional fast bowlers like Jasprit Bumrah, Pat Cummins, Kagiso Rabada, and Jofra Archer, who combine traditional skills with modern athleticism and sports science.
The art and science of fast bowling have evolved significantly since cricket's early days, influenced by changes in equipment, playing conditions, coaching methods, and athletic preparation.
In cricket's formative years, bowling was primarily underarm. The transition to roundarm and then overarm bowling in the 19th century created the foundation for modern fast bowling. Early pioneers like Fred Spofforth demonstrated the potential of pace bowling to dominate matches.

The 20th century saw numerous technical innovations that transformed fast bowling. The development of swing bowling, particularly through English bowlers like Maurice Tate and later Sarfraz Nawaz's discovery of reverse swing, added new dimensions to pace bowling. The West Indian quartet of the 1970s and 80s demonstrated the effectiveness of sustained short-pitched bowling.
Contemporary cricket has seen increased specialization among fast bowlers. Distinct roles have emerged including the new-ball specialist, first-change bowler, death-overs expert, and the genuine fast bowler who focuses on extreme pace. The rise of T20 cricket has further refined these specializations, with bowlers developing specific skills for different phases of the game.

The presence of a qualityFast Bowlerfundamentally shapes team strategy, influencing everything from captaincy decisions to field placements and match approach.
A skilledFast Bowlercan change the complexion of a match within a few overs. Their ability to take quick wickets, build pressure through dot balls, and break partnerships makes them invaluable assets. In Test cricket, fast bowlers often operate in spells, with captains carefully managing their workload to maximize effectiveness.
The characteristics of aFast Bowleroften determine how a team approaches different pitch conditions. On green, seaming pitches, swing and seam bowlers become central to strategy. On hard, bouncy tracks, tall fast bowlers who can extract bounce come to the fore. In subcontinental conditions, reverse swing specialists often prove decisive.
The rise of limited-overs cricket has created specialized roles for fast bowlers. Powerplay specialists focus on taking early wickets with the new ball, while death bowlers develop variations to contain batsmen in the final overs. The economic value of a versatileFast Bowlerin T20 leagues worldwide demonstrates their continued importance across formats.
The role and requirements of aFast Bowlervary significantly across cricket's different formats, each demanding specific skills and approaches.
In Test matches, fast bowlers require endurance, consistency, and the ability to bowl long spells. Building pressure over sustained periods and exploiting changing pitch conditions are crucial skills.
ODIs demand versatility from fast bowlers, who must adapt to different phases of the game. Powerplay bowling, middle-over containment, and death bowling require distinct approaches within the same match.
The T20 format emphasizes specific skills and variations. Yorkers, slower balls, and wide yorkers become essential weapons. Economy rates often become as important as wicket-taking ability.
Despite these format-specific demands, the fundamental qualities of a successfulFast Bowlerremain consistent across all forms of cricket: physical fitness, technical proficiency, mental toughness, and the ability to execute under pressure.
